...
需求:使用shell脚本把sql数据文件导入到docker版的MySQL服务 方法一:适合写入判断语句等 比如备份数据 root vrgv app vim .sh mysqlid docker ps aqf name mysql docker exec i mysqlid bash lt lt EOF mysqldump导出表结构和数据if d backup then mkdir p backup ...
2020-12-09 16:22 0 777 推荐指数:
...
《容器访问外部世界:》 原理:NAT地址转换 1.物理机可以连接外网 2.docker run -it busybox ip a 容器可以访问外网 3.查看iptables策略,了解策略原理 iptables -t nat -s ...
Docker默认的文件目录位于Linux server的/var/lib/docker 下面。目录结构如下 |-----containers:用于存储容器信息 |-----image:用来存储镜像中间件及本身信息,大小,依赖信息 |-----network ...
转自:https://www.cnblogs.com/kevingrace/p/9453987.html Docker允许通过外部访问容器或者容器之间互联的方式来提供网络服务。容器启动之后,容器中可以运行一些网络应用,通过-p或-P参数来指定端口映射。 注意:宿主机的一个端口只能映射 ...
...
Dockerfile: 配置中给与变量:application.properties 用于Test: 运行镜像 : ...
容器是镜像的一个运行实例,镜像是静态的只读文件,而容器带有运行时需要的可写文件层。如果认为虚拟机是模拟运行的一整套操作系统(包括内核、应用运行态环境和其他系统环境)和跑在上面的应用,那么Docker容器就是独立运行的一个(或一组)应用,以及它们必需的运行环境。 一、创建容器 1. 新建容器 ...
docker image docker image是一个极度精简版的Linux程序运行环境,官网的java镜像包括的东西更少,除非是镜像叠加方式的如centos+java7 docker image是需要定制化build的一个安装包,包括基础镜像+应用的二进制部署包 docker image ...